\r\n

51Degrees IP Intelligence Java  4.4

IP Intelligence services for 51Degrees Pipeline

Classes

51Degrees Java classes. These contain the interfaces and logic of the IP Intelligence API.
[detail level 12345678]
Nfiftyone
Nipintelligence
Ncloud
Ndata
CIPIntelligenceDataCloud
Cloud specific interface for IPIntelligenceData
CMultiIPIDataCloud
Encapsulates a list of IPIntelligenceData instances which can be returned by the 51Degrees cloud service when certain evidence is provided (e.g
Nflowelements
CHardwareProfileCloudEngine
Engine that takes the JSON response from the CloudRequestEngine and uses it populate a MultiIPIDataCloud instance for easier consumption
CHardwareProfileCloudEngineBuilder
CIPIntelligenceCloudEngine
Engine that takes the JSON response from the CloudRequestEngine and uses it populate a IPIntelligenceDataCloud instance for easier consumption
CIPIntelligenceCloudEngineBuilder
Builder for the IPIntelligenceCloudEngine
CIPIntelligenceDataCloudInternal
Internal implementation of the IPIntelligenceDataCloud interface
Nengine
Nonpremise
Ndata
CComponentMetaDataIPI
On-premise implementation of the ComponentMetaData interface
CIPIntelligenceDataHash
On-premise specific interface for IPIntelligenceData
CProfileMetaDataIPI
On-premise implementation of the ProfileMetaData interface
CPropertyMetaDataIPI
On-premise implementation of the FiftyOneAspectPropertyMetaData interface
CValueMetaDataIPI
On-premise implementation of the ValueMetaData interface
Nflowelements
CIPIntelligenceDataHashDefault
Internal implementation of the IPIntelligenceDataHash interface
CIPIntelligenceOnPremiseEngine
On-premise IP Intelligence engine
CIPIntelligenceOnPremiseEngineBuilder
Builder for the IPIntelligenceOnPremiseEngine
Ninterop
Nswig
CComponentIterable
Class which adds the Iterable and AutoCloseable interfaces to a native collection representing ComponentMetaDatas
CConstants
CProfileIterable
Class which adds the Iterable and AutoCloseable interfaces to a native collection representing ProfileMetaDatas
CPropertyIterable
Class which adds the Iterable and AutoCloseable interfaces to a native collection representing FiftyOneAspectPropertyMetaDatas
CSwig
Static methods to help interoperability through the SWIG layer to C++
CValueIterable
Class which adds the Iterable and AutoCloseable interfaces to a native collection representing ValueMetaDatas
CEnums
CMatchMethods
Enumeration of possible match methods used by the Hash engine
Nexamples
Nconsole
CGettingStartedOnPrem
Provides an illustration of the fundamental elements of carrying out IP Intelligence using "on premise" detection - meaning the IP Intelligence data is stored on your server and the detection software executes exclusively on your server
CGettingStartedOnPremTest
CLoggerOutputStream
CMetadataOnPrem
CMetadataOnPremTest
COfflineProcessing
Provides an example of processing a YAML file containing evidence for IP Intelligence
COfflineProcessingTest
CPerformanceBenchmark
The example illustrates the flexibility with which the 51Degrees pipeline can be configured to achieve a range of outcomes relating to speed, accuracy, predictive power, memory usage
CPerformanceConfiguration
CPerformanceBenchmarkTest
CUpdateDataFile
This example illustrates various parameters that can be adjusted when using the on-premise IP Intelligence engine, and controls when a new data file is sought and when it is loaded by the IP Intelligence software
CUpdateDataFileTest
Nshared
CDataFileHelper
CDatafileInfo
CEvidenceHelper
CKeyHelper
CPropertyHelper
CPropertyHelperTest
Nweb
CEmbedJetty
CGettingStartedWebOnPrem
This is the getting started Web/On-Prem example showing use of the 51Degrees supplied filter which automatically creates and configures a IP Intelligence pipeline
CGettingStartedWebOnPremTest
CHtmlContentHelper
Nshared
Nflowelements
COnPremiseIPIntelligenceEngineBuilderBase
Base builder class for 51Degrees on-premise IP Intelligence engines
Ntesthelpers
CFileUtils
CKeyUtils
Helpers to obtain keys from the environment
CConstants
CIPIntelligenceData
Interface exposing typed accessors for properties related to an IP
CIPIntelligenceDataBase
CIPIntelligenceDataBaseOnPremise
Base class used for all 51Degrees on-premise IP Intelligence results classes
CEnums
CIPIntelligenceAlgorithm
CIPIntelligenceCloudPipelineBuilder
Builder used to create pipelines with an cloud-based IP Intelligence engine
CIPIntelligenceOnPremisePipelineBuilder
Builder used to create pipelines with an on-premise IP Intelligence engine
CIPIntelligencePipelineBuilder
Builder used to create a Pipeline with a IP Intelligence engine